Fishery Sector Needs Bank Assistance

Tempo Interactive, Friday, 11 December, 2009 | 11:12 WIB


TEMPO Interactive, Jakarta: The Maritime and Fishery Minister Fadel Muhammad has called for a special allocation for the fishery sector around 20 to 25 percent from the People’s Businesses Credit (KUR) or Rp20 trillion per year.


“If this is approved, Rp500 billion can be allocated for the first stage,” Fadel said.


The request was intended to reach the target for fishery products in 2015 which went up to 353 percent.


The fund is used to create new businessmen in the fishery sector.


Farmers raising fish in ponds also need to be encouraged to develop new ponds.
